The annual American Association of Cancer Research meeting (AACR) was held April 18–22 in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. Attendance for the conference was 19,300, up about 4% from last year (see IBO 4/30/14). The number of companies exhibiting totaled 438. Company Announcements Cepheid 2014 Non-Clinical revenue declined 29.9% to $29.0 million, or 6% of total revenues, primarily due to lower sales of anthrax test cartridges. North America accounted for 86% of Non-Clinical sales. Non-Clinical revenue is expected to decline again this year. Biologic drugs continue to be one of the fastest-growing categories of the pharmaceutical market. US sales of biologics grew 9.7% annually from 2010 to 2012 to $65.5 billion, or 47% of the global market, according to EvaluatePharma.
